Types of Lists
Throughout OASIS, groups of titles are called lists. Depending on the workflow or type of list, they may posses similar behaviors or not. Some lists are considered "system" lists. These will either always appear or may appear based on the user's role at the library. Titles which are actioned (selected, ordered) from a "system" list will automatically be removed from the list. These lists may include, but are not limited to:
- Inbox
- Shopping Cart
- Authorize Orders
- Sent to Ratifier
- Slip Notifications
In addition to "system" lists, OASIS supports user defined Custom Lists.
Users may create as many custom lists as they need, though at this time we recommend keeping lists to 500 titles or fewer in order to ensure system stability. Users cannot access colleagues’ custom lists; however, there is a golden check status phrase “On a List” in the browse row, and a similar phrase in the Check Status tab of the split screen, to notify customers when they are viewing a title which a colleague within the same library has added to a list.
Titles will remain on a custom list until the user chooses to remove them, even if they are ordered or added to another list.

Creating custom lists
There are a variety of ways to create new lists, depending on the specific activity the user is completing.
1. Creating a list while browsing a group of titles such as search results or slip notifications
- Using the green action arrow or bulk action buttons choose the List/Forward option.
- Enter a name for your new list in the New List box and click Create List. (This will move your new list to the top of any existing lists, where you can then easily select it.
- NOTE: After moving to a list, you will be given the option to add order information. If you do not want to add information now, deselect "Show Order Info" in the bottom left of the Order Info dialogue box and select Skip.
- If you do not wish to add the title to the list, exit out of the dialog (there is no save button; you've already saved by creating the list).
2. Creating a list while viewing other custom lists
- While on the My Lists or Lists & Groups page choose the Create New List button in the upper right corner.
- Change the Description field to the name of your new list.
- Ignore the List Life-Cycle functionality.
- Ensure that the box for Slip Forward Eligible is checked if you wish to move slips to this list.
- Modify the email notification settings as desired
- Be sure to save the dialog before closing.
3. Creating a list which maintaining all lists (not just custom lists)
- Navigate to Account Settings and choose the List Maintenance tab.
- In the right-hand corner of the split screen choose the Add New List button.
- Everything else is exactly like creating a list from within the Lists page, as per #2, except that it happens in the bottom split screen, instead of in a pop-up dialog.
Adding titles to a custom list
It is easy to add titles to a list. From any browse row screen
use either the green action arrow for single titles or the bulk action buttons for multiple titles and choose the List/Forward option.
Select the list you would like to add your titles to.
- If you want to add order information at this time, make sure the left-hand box is checked before clicking Send.
- If you want to move titles from one list to another, make sure the right-hand box is checked to "Remove affected title(s) from page" before clicking Send.
Setting up email notifications
OASIS offers several options for receiving email notifications when new titles have been added to any list, whether it is a customer list or a system list. These options can be managed using the List Maintenance functionality, from either the Lists page (using the green action arrow) or from Account Settings.
Here you can set preferences for each list:
- Frequency with which emails will be sent
- Whether you would like to include a "Recommend" and "Reject" button for each title
- Plain text format or HTML
- And the email address to which the notification will be sent
NOTE: "Instant" notifications can take 15 minutes or longer, depending on the list and the number of notifications. (Slip notification emails may take even longer.) All other notifications are delivered in the early morning (North America). We do not recommend using the monthly notification option at this time.
In the List/Forward dialog, Custom Lists with email notifications will be found under the
"E-mail" section, after the "Lists" section.
The email will come from the alias YourLibraryLiaison@proquest.com and may contain the subject line "Selections in [
list name]" or "Title(s) for your Consideration"
For titles using the
Recommendation functionality, clicking on either link (Recommend or Reject) will allow the faculty selector to view any notes you have included and add a note back to you. Their response will appear in your Inbox, with a note that includes their name and whether they have recommended or rejected the title.
Sharing custom lists with colleagues
While OASIS does not currently support the ability to send a list to a colleague as a single unit, there are 2 options for sharing custom lists with colleagues.
- Depending on the need, one option might be to set up email notifications for the colleague as described above.
- Another option is to forward titles to a colleague's Inbox.
To Forward titles to a colleague:
- From within a list, click the checkbox to check all titles.
- Then, using the Bulk Action buttons, choose the List/Forward option, just as you would to add titles to a list.
- Instead of selecting a list, choose a colleague from the Forwarding section, at the bottom of the dialog.
- NOTE: Individual users must have "Accepts Forwarding" turned on in their Account Settings > Preferences in order to be listed here.
The titles will appear in your colleague's In Box with a note in the browse row that includes your name and the name of your list.
